The Running Ability Factor
One of the key aspects that sets Murray apart is his exceptional running ability. He believes, and rightly so, that his ability to move around and make plays with his legs is a game-changer. In his own words, it's something that 'just happens' for him during games, and it's tough to replicate that in practice.
What makes this particularly fascinating is the psychological aspect. Murray's instinctive running ability creates an element of unpredictability on the field. Defenses will have to second-guess their moves, and this hesitation could create opportunities for his receivers to get open. It's like a chess match, where Murray's unique skill set forces the defense to adapt and potentially make mistakes.
The Impact on the Passing Game
Murray's running ability isn't just a flashy feature; it has a profound impact on the entire offensive strategy. The Vikings' quarterbacks coach, Josh McCown, has highlighted this dynamic. By keeping defenses on their toes, Murray makes the passing game easier. It's a clever strategy that leverages Murray's natural talent to create advantages for the entire team.
Consistency and the Vikings' Plan
The Vikings' decision to stick with Murray all year is a strategic move. Coach Kevin O'Connell has emphasized the importance of consistency, especially given the team's playoff success in years with a consistent quarterback. In contrast, the years without a stable quarterback saw the team struggle.
This consistency allows Murray to continue learning and mastering the offense. It's a long-term investment in his development, and with his unique skills, the Vikings could be setting themselves up for a successful season.
